poor mid range sound?

hi,
this is my first post here so bear with me if iv posted in the wrong section, i gotta swift and i have a very simple audio setup in my car, it goes somewhat like this, pioneer headunit, pair of pioneer 6'' by 9'' in the rear on a custom built tray, a sony 4 channel amplifier XM-ZR604, a 12" sub sony XS-L120P5H in a custom made mdf enclosure, plain old 500 buck rca, now i know this isnt exactly a great setup but this was all what was available here so had to manage somehow, neways my problem is that though sound is reasonably good but because of absence of front speakers and coz of lotta bass coming from that sub, the mid range is pretty weak, im not a big fan of tweeters and i mostly am interested in mid range vocals and instrumental sound so iv decided to buy a mid range pair of speakers, now my query is what options do i have, whether i should buy a component speaker setup or what, i would love if u guys could recommend something from sony or pioneer preferably coz thats all whats available here, so advise accordingly friends

try this reduce the volume on your subwoofer amplifier so that it only reaches higher volumes as you increase volume on the head unit. that will considerably increase the kind of output you get from the speakers. second reduce the loudness on your head unit. yes it will mean going through the manual and learning that but it'll be good practice. change the balance so that it plays only rears this will help redirect all the sound to only the rear speakers. its a neat little work around without killing your wallet.

Quote:
Originally Posted by makanaka View Post
... i dont want to install them in my door, id prefer it on the pillars if possible, is it possible to install a component setup without their woofer counterpart, i mean just the mid range and tweeter and not the sub woofer cone, my budget is 5-6 k, is it possible to get a decent pair of component in this price range, i dont want the best just a decent pair , so say what ???
Relax and take it easy, @makanaka, your purse is ruling your mind, not the other way around.
1. Much of the vocal & instrumental information in music spans a rather wide band: ~80Hz (low notes) to ~ 8Khz (basic harmonics of the high notes, which give the tonal character)
2. The "mid-bass" driver of a common component set covers the lower part of this region, till ~4Khz, efficiently. The upper part, starting from ~2Khz, is covered by the tweeter
2. The region below 80 Hz is usually covered by the sub or to some extent by the ovals
3. The region above 8Khz gives the real definition of the high notes because of the higher harmonics of vocals and instruments
4. All these need to be well integrated for your brain to be able to sense the critical information for building an "image"

Miss any of these, and music will be like food without flavor - can be eaten but not much enjoyment. Tabla will sound like pakhawaj, Sunidhi will sound like Himesh and Jagjit like he has a perpetual sinus problem on top of breathing helium.

* The mid-bass is always too large to mount on the pillar, and it needs some air volume behind it to function well
* One gets a mid-range only with 3-way components, and these start at about 20K!
* Swift has standard 6.5" mounting location in the front door, and no modifications are needed except for tweeter mounting
* Browse through the different threads - there are many Swift ICE installation pics here (search)

A decent component set from JBL or Blaupunkt should be 5-6K with b&w, and as Gunbir pointed out, you should be able to get it in Dehradun. If not, ask someone to get you the stuff from Delhi and get them mounted under your supervision - make sure they don't twist wires and leave it, but either solder it to the speaker terminal or use crimping lugs. (Crossovers have screw mounting - hopefully they wont mess *that*)
